Exceptional in every way. I frequent the Naples area for work on a regular basis and TFK is absolutely my favorite restaurant where I have been known to go three evenings in a row! People often ask me with all the wonderful restaurant options in the Naples area, why do you go there all the time. I say the same thing. The menu is incredible, healthy, and diverse. The staff from the greeter to the servers, those serving the bar, and those in the kitchen that often times assist with being some of the food out are all so profession, courteous, and nice. I live the the Tampa Bay Area, and I do go to the Tampa location, but the Naples location has set the bar incredibly high. I took the time to observe of the multiple times I have been there and it all leads to one thing. The Naples location has an incredible manager, Jacob. Jacob regularly can be seen going around and checking on each guest, assisting the servers and willing to step in. You can tell he works hard and his team really respects him. He always goes out of his way to make me feel welcomed and appreciated and I see him doing the same for other customers as well. I left dinner tonight feeling compelled to leave this review as I had such a wonderful enjoyable experience. Hats off to Jacob. He is a tremendous asset to the restaurant. For those that haven’t tried the restaurant, I highly recommend. The menu is exceptional and changes from season to season. I’ve loved everything I have, but personally can’t wait till they bring back the sea bass dish. I always start with a relaxing tulsi tea and end the evening with the hot matcha horchata, which is incredibly good! Thanks again for the great food but most importantly a great experience each and every time.

So atmosphere place itself are always nice and beautiful. Well, the hostess was really nice. Our waiter was a bit dry and quick and they weren’t very busy. There were four of us eating. We ordered three appetizers, the Brussels, the dumplings and the cauliflower. All of them were good really loved the mushrooms that were in the brussels sprouts and whatever sauce they had was delicious, I had th OG burger with the fingerling potatoes The burger was OK it lacked a little bit of flavor, The fingerling potatoes were cooked nice but again no flavor they needed like some rosemary all the way on salt or something. I tried the other three dishes which were the chicken Panini which I’ve had that before it’s good, the trout which I had not I think it was the best meal, and the lasagna Bolognese I’d also had before it was pretty good. I know it’s a healthy place so they probably stay away from over salting the potatoes or the meat but the cauliflower and the Brussels had such good spices flavors and taste I know that they can improve on the burger and the potatoes, I would definitely recommend checking it out. Even though I didn’t have them this time, the curry is delicious and they have the best kale salad.
